● Servicing Position
a. Remove the Top Cover and the Front Panel Unit.
b. Remove 6 screws ( y ) in Fig. 3.
c. Remove 5 screws ( u ) in Fig. 3.
d. Remove 3 screws ( i ) in Fig. 3.
e. Remove the Power Transformer and Main P.C.B. (with the rear panel attached) from the main
chassis.
f. With the rear panel attached, set the Main P.C.B on its side. At this time, set the Power Trans-
former on its side as well in Fig. 4.
g. Using a lead wire or the like, connect G250 of the Main (1) P.C.B. with the rear panel in Fig. 4.
h. With the Front Panel Unit set on its side, connect 4 connectors (CB251, CB253, CB210, CB406)
in Fig. 5.
i. Connect the power cable, turn on the power and check for operation.

■ AMP ADJUSTMENTS
● Confirmation of Idling Current
1) No signal applied.
2) Non-loaded condition.
3) Aging is not neccessary.
Item Test Point Rating (DC) Note
MAIN L R319 If the measured voltage exceeds 2.5mV, cut the lead wire of R308(L ch)
(Between terminal) or R309(R ch) and then check again if each measured value satisfies the
0.05mV—2.5mV rating.

RX CDX M DX KX
U, C, R, G models
• The power cord of each unit is connected to the AC outlet in series and switched on and off
through the RX relay.
• Turning off the RX power switch will turn off the power to other units (primary connection) but
turning off the power switch of any other unit will turn off the secondary connection of each unit
only (i.e., the microprocessor remains on).
• Each unit has a backup function to save the secondary connection status when unplugged
(taking use of a unit alone into consideration)
• The indicators of units are turned on after a dimmer level signal is fed from RX so that they light
up simultaneously when the RX power switch is turned on. However, as the indicator of a unit
does not light up when the unit is used alone in this setting, the indicator is forced to turn on when
2 seconds have elapsed without a dimmer level signal being fed (and the power for the backup
function is turned on). When the CD unit is used alone, the timer play mode is set regardless of
the backup function status.
• Make sure that the power off processing of each unit has been completed before turning off the
power by using the RX relay.
6) Dimmer
RX-E400
There are 7 dimmer level settings. The dimmer level data is transmmitted from the
receiver when the power is turned on. The dimmer level is “0” when a unit is used alone.
